logo

Output 3d56dce31deae33f70768df5e818f519a75b815d633eb1f0e71c6cabbe22e2e5:1

value
17058498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0094b4404add8aee095fb7bbad5df7926ea6f69 OP_EQUAL
address
3PaDELnbM66q4ysubSkNYJWvs3DXSDfnFs
transaction
3d56dce31deae33f70768df5e818f519a75b815d633eb1f0e71c6cabbe22e2e5